Obamas Honor Stevie Wonder With Library of Congress Gershwin Prize for Popular Song

President Barack Obama on Wednesday thanked musician Stevie Wonder for creating 'a style that's uniquely American' as he presented the singer-songwriter the nation's highest award for pop music.
